timeline
7/22: submitted aacomas
7/28: lecom-b received aacomas
7/29: secondary received
8/2: submitted secondary
8/3: lecom-b processed aacomas
9/11: received video interview invite
9/22: submitted video interview
10/7: received zoom link via email
10/9: attended mandatory zoom info session
10/12: all turned green except red X for MCAT (applied AIS- submitted both ACT (126) & SAT (122), expired MCAT score 7/2017, cum gpa: 3.7)
11/19: status on portal changed from under review post-interview to decision has been made
11/27: received letter in mail... waitlisted & will find out latest 7/2021 regarding status

next steps... thinking about calling the school & inquiring about what happened- will likely email a letter of intent as those who are still interested are allowed to do so within a fortnight of receiving the letter stating the decision, though i think the biggest problem is that i mentioned i would retake the MCAT 9/28 & never did. my expired mcat score is really low, which is why i used AIS. i will likely ask if i may have a benefit taking the mcat in 2021 to increase my chances. not sure. anyone else have any advice? feel free to DM about advice, anything about this post, etc.

i figured posting this timeline would help someone else out.
